Abstract

Sliding door for motor vehicles, having an outer door skin, an inner door skin and a door inside trim, supported on a guide rail on a vehicle body and movable between opened and closed positions. The sliding door includes a cable guide assembly for accommodating and guiding electric cables, which connect first electric elements provided in or on the vehicle body to second electric elements provided on the sliding door, whereby on moving the sliding door, the cable guide assembly is movable in a plane including the longitudinal direction of the vehicle and whereby a guide channel for guiding the cable guide assembly is provided on moving the sliding door. Guide surfaces of the guide channel are formed or integrated at least in sections on the inner door skin, in a door module support and/or on the door inside trim.
